Noun canara has 1 sense
  1. Kanara, Canara - a historical region of southwestern India on the west coast
    --1 is a kind of geographical area, geographic area, geographical region, geographic region
    --1 is a part of India, Republic of India, Bharat

Definitions from the Web


Noun (1): Canara refers to a region in southwestern India, primarily covering the coastal districts of Karnataka state. The region is known for its scenic beauty, lush greenery, and picturesque beaches.

Example sentence: The beaches in Canara attract tourists from all over the world.

Noun (2): Canara is also the name of a river that flows through the Canara region in India.

Example sentence: The Canara river is an important water source for the surrounding villages.

Adjective: When used as an adjective, Canara describes something or someone that is related to the Canara region.

Example sentence: We enjoyed a Canara-style meal at the traditional restaurant.

